This is the best Jamaican food I’ve had in Colombus! The food was fresh and hot and the portions were worth the price. I ordered the brown stew chicken, Mac and cheese, cabbage, plantain and potato salad with rice and peas. I ordered one plate and ate it all in the car and ORDERED ANOTHER for the roadtrip home. The restaurant it’s self is a very nice vibe. The music creates a nice atmosphere that is infectious and uplifting. The ladies in the kitchen were working hard as fast as possible considering there was a line to the door. These ladies are doing a great job. I’m grateful to eat their food! This is a must eat in Colombus! Thanks y’all.
